PROPERTIES OF AMMONIA Physical properties 1. It is a colourless gas with a choking smell. 2. It is slightly less dense than air and thus collected by upward delivery. 3. It is an alkaline gas and therefore turns red litmus blue. 4. the m80s

WebLitmus is obtained from organisms called lichens. The dye is prepared by crushing the lichens and fermenting them in a mixture of ammonia and potash. The fermented matter, which is blue, is mixed with chalk to form a paste, which is dried and powdered. Red litmus is made by adding acid. Litmus is usually used in the form of litmus paper - the ...
